4542 Views •How To Reset a Profile To Default Settings
If you've experimented with settings in the output mixer section of your profile and want to reset all of the output mixer to default settings, the tutorial below will be helpful.
Click the settings button on your profile
Select the 'Output Mixer' tab
Click the 'Tuning Wizard' button.
Select 'Reset To Defaults' and click 'Next'-->'Finish'
All settings in your output mixer have now been reset to factory defaults for the selected profile.
Alternatively, you can simply delete a profile by hovering over it, selecting 'Delete' and then auto-detecting new games by following these simple steps: https://www.simxperience.com/slides/slide/how-to-auto-discover-games-profiles-47?search_category=44
This would reset the entire profile, not just the output mixer.
